HUMAN ANATOMY AND PHYSIOLOGY-2
Human Anatomy and Physiology-2 is a core subject in B.Pharmacy Semester 2 that provides a detailed understanding of the structure and functions of the human body's major organ systems. The course covers the cardiovascular, respiratory, digestive, urinary, endocrine, and reproductive systems, along with their physiological mechanisms and regulatory processes. By studying this subject, students develop a strong foundation in normal human body functions, which is essential for understanding disease mechanisms, pharmacology, and the therapeutic actions of drugs in clinical pharmacy practice.
PHARMACEUTICAL ORGANIC CHEMISTRY-I
Pharmaceutical Organic Chemistry-1 is a fundamental subject in B.Pharmacy Semester 2 that introduces students to the principles of organic chemistry essential for pharmaceutical sciences. The course focuses on the structure, nomenclature, stereochemistry, and chemical behavior of organic compounds, along with the study of reaction mechanisms and functional groups. It provides a strong conceptual foundation for understanding drug molecules, their synthesis, physicochemical properties, and pharmaceutical applications. Mastery of this subject is essential for advanced courses such as Medicinal Chemistry, Pharmaceutical Analysis, and Drug Design, making it a cornerstone of pharmacy education and research.
BIOCHEMISTRY
Biochemistry is a core subject in B.Pharmacy Semester 2 that explores the chemical processes and molecular mechanisms underlying the functioning of living organisms. The course covers the structure, function, and metabolism of biomolecules such as carbohydrates, proteins, lipids, nucleic acids, enzymes, and vitamins, along with essential metabolic pathways and bioenergetics. It provides students with a comprehensive understanding of cellular functions, biochemical reactions, and the molecular basis of health and disease. A strong foundation in biochemistry is essential for studying Pharmacology, Pathophysiology, Clinical Pharmacy, and Pharmaceutical Biotechnology, as it helps explain how drugs interact with biological systems at the molecular level.
PATHOPHYSIOLOGY
Pathophysiology is a fundamental subject in B.Pharmacy Semester 2 that focuses on the study of disease processes and the functional changes that occur in the human body as a result of various disorders. The course explains the causes, mechanisms, clinical manifestations, and progression of diseases affecting different organ systems, including the cardiovascular, respiratory, endocrine, renal, and nervous systems. By understanding the underlying pathophysiological mechanisms, students develop the ability to correlate normal physiology with disease conditions and appreciate the scientific basis of drug therapy. This subject serves as a vital link between basic medical sciences and clinical pharmacy, providing the foundation for advanced studies in Pharmacology, Pharmacotherapeutics, and Patient Care.
COMPUTER APPLICATIONS IN PHARMACY
Computer Applications in Pharmacy is an essential subject in B.Pharmacy Semester 2 that introduces students to the role of computer technology and digital tools in modern pharmaceutical education, research, healthcare, and the pharmaceutical industry. The course covers the fundamentals of computer systems, operating software, databases, internet applications, data analysis, and the use of information technology in drug discovery, hospital pharmacy, community pharmacy, and pharmaceutical management. Students also gain practical knowledge of documentation, statistical software, digital communication, and pharmacy information systems. This subject equips future pharmacists with the technical skills required to efficiently manage pharmaceutical data, improve healthcare services, and adapt to the rapidly evolving digital landscape of pharmacy practice.
ENVIRONMENTAL SCIENCES
Environmental Sciences is a multidisciplinary subject in B.Pharmacy Semester 2 that provides students with a comprehensive understanding of the environment, natural resources, ecosystems, biodiversity, and sustainable development. The course emphasizes the impact of human activities and pharmaceutical industries on the environment, including pollution, waste management, environmental conservation, and public health. Students learn about environmental laws, disaster management, climate change, and strategies for protecting ecological balance. This subject helps future pharmacists develop environmental awareness, promote sustainable healthcare practices, and understand their professional responsibility in minimizing the environmental impact of pharmaceutical activities while contributing to public and environmental well-being.
